### Air Cooling Reinvented
Air cooling has long been a popular choice for cooling computer components due to its simplicity and affordability. However, recent innovations have brought about significant improvements in air cooling solutions. One of the most notable advancements is the development of high-performance air coolers with larger heatsinks and more efficient heat pipes. These coolers are designed to dissipate heat effectively while maintaining low noise levels, making them ideal for both casual users and enthusiasts alike.
### Liquid Cooling at Its Best
Liquid cooling, once considered a niche option for hardcore enthusiasts, has now become more accessible and mainstream. This technology involves circulating liquid coolant through a system of tubes and blocks to draw heat away from components. The result is superior cooling performance and quieter operation compared to air coolers. Recent innovations in liquid cooling have focused on improving ease of installation and maintenance, making it more user-friendly for beginners. Additionally, the introduction of all-in-one liquid coolers has made liquid cooling more convenient and cost-effective for a wider range of users.
### The Rise of AIO Coolers
All-in-one (AIO) liquid coolers have gained popularity in recent years for their combination of performance and convenience. These coolers come pre-assembled and pre-filled, eliminating the need for custom loops and reducing the risk of leaks. AIO coolers typically consist of a radiator, pump, and water block, all housed in a single unit that can be easily installed in most PC cases. The compact nature of AIO coolers makes them an attractive option for users looking to enhance their cooling without the complexity of traditional liquid cooling setups.
### Smart Cooling Solutions
In the age of smart technology, it comes as no surprise that cooling solutions have also become smarter. Manufacturers are incorporating intelligent features such as temperature sensors, fan speed control, and RGB lighting integration into their cooling products. These smart cooling solutions allow users to monitor and adjust their system’s cooling performance in real-time, ensuring optimal temperature management and performance. Some advanced coolers even come with software that enables customization and synchronization with other components for a cohesive aesthetic.
